Latest Patents

One of Ke Liu's latest patents involves the use of delta tocopherol for the treatment of lysosomal storage disorders. This disclosure outlines a novel application of delta tocopherol in addressing diseases related to lysosomal storage disorders. The patent includes methods for modulating cholesterol recycling and addresses conditions such as Niemann-Pick type C disease, Farber disease, Niemann-Pick type A disease, Wolman disease, and Tay Sachs disease. Additionally, the patent describes a method for treating these disorders through the administration of delta tocopherol, both alone and in combination with cyclodextrin.
